Stanley Schibler was recovering from a recent liver transplant in his Beaver Lake Road cabin Aug. 31, 2014, when there was a knock on his door.
When he got to the door he was asked to help with a man injured when his quad went off the road and down a steep embankment. The man香蕉视频直播檚 name, he later learned, was Jules Delorme.

Schibler, 62, visited Delorme in hospital once he was allowed. Delorme had suffered a broken spine, jaw and suffered a brain injury. He was completely immobile and recovering from a coma that lasted six months.

They lost touch for the next few years.
Then, by chance, the pair reconnected at CONNECT Communities in August, a brain injury clinic in Lake Country, which happens to be near Schibler香蕉视频直播檚 house.

Delorme walked out of his room with assistance down the hall and came back by himself walking with two canes.

Delorme said his recovery has been a 香蕉视频直播渃razy journey.香蕉视频直播
Doctors told him the likelihood of recovering the use of his legs was slim, he said.
Despite a tough battle, taking him to various places in the Central Okanagan and Manitoba, Delorme persevered.
He had two goals: to go to the gym regularly and to get his own place.
Two weeks ago, he achieved both. He moved into his own place on Leon Avenue in Kelowna.
